Fasinex 240 is an oral flukicide for the treatment and control of triclabendazole-sensitive strains of liver fluke (Fasciola hepatica) in cattle and sheep.

Fasinex 240 contains triclabendazole, an active belonging to the benzimidazole family of drenches which has efficacy against early immature, immature and mature stages of liver fluke.

Dosage and Administration:

Cattle:
2.5mL / 50kg bodyweight administered orally using a 30mL Fasinex applicator or 30mL Genesis Power Doser (fitted with a floating hook).

Sheep:
0.5mL / 10kg bodyweight administered orally using a NJ Phillips 8mL applicator.

Do not underdose.

In areas where Black Disease is known to occur, adequate vaccination procedures are advised.

Target Species and Pests

For the treatment of triclabendazole-susceptible Early Immature, Immature and Mature liver fluke (Fasciola hepatica) in cattle and sheep.

FASINEX 240 when used at the recommended rate of 12mg triclabendazole/kg bodyweight for cattle (i.e. 2.5ml/50kg BW) and a minimum dose of 10mg triclabendazole/kg bodyweight for sheep, is highly effective against susceptible early immature fluke as well as immature and adult fluke.

Note: Resistance may develop to any drench. It is advisable that a drench resistance test be conducted before any drench is used.

Dose rate & administration

Administer orally. Cattle: 2.5 mL per 50 kg (12 mg triclabendazole/kg). Sheep: 0.5 mL per 10 kg. Effective against early immature, immature and adult stages of liver fluke (Fasciola hepatica). Shake well before use. Do not use in lactating cows or within 21 days of calving.

Tips for Best Results

  • Weigh animals accurately using scales — never estimate liveweight. Underdosing is one of the leading contributors to drench resistance in liver fluke populations.
  • Triclabendazole is currently the only registered flukicide effective against all three stages of liver fluke in Australia, making it a critical tool — use it strategically and only when fluke burden is confirmed to preserve its efficacy. Resistance to triclabendazole has been reported in some areas, so monitor treatment outcomes and discuss testing options with your vet.
  • Where possible, time treatments based on seasonal fluke risk and diagnostic results (faecal egg counts or liver inspection at slaughter) rather than treating routinely — this supports refugia principles by avoiding unnecessary treatment pressure on fluke populations.
  • Store below 30°C out of direct sunlight, and keep out of reach of children and animals. Shake well before use and keep the container tightly sealed between uses.
  • Keep accurate treatment records including date, mob, liveweights, dose administered, batch number, and withholding period — this is best practice and essential for QA programs such as LPA/NVD compliance.
